The month of September is Suicide Prevention Awareness Month. It is said that investment in suicide education, prevention, and research assists with decreasing the number of untimely deaths each year.  

  

Our theme this month is ‘Stay Connected.’ During times of uncertainty, it is important students are connected to healthy friendships, school activities, trusted adults and needed resources. We must teach students to ACT- Acknowledge, Care and Tell.
